language

Hiep hiep hoera, anti joods en de latijnse val


Mooi dat internet. "Gaat heel groot worden" zei ik als grap 10 jaar geleden... Grap is al heel lang niet meer leuk. Difficilis facilis, iucundus acerbus es idem: Nec tecum possum vivere, nec sine te.

Wel leuk, elke debiel kan "er iets opzetten", Ecce signum

Dus de ene debiel mompelt wat over dat "Hiep Hiep Hoera" roepen anti semitisch is op zijn jaren 80 blog (Ad vocem):

Velen zijn onbekend met de duistere en antisemitische achtergrond van de kreet HIEP! HIEP! HOERA!

Het woord "hiep" komt vanuit het Latijn. Het was oorspronkelijk HEP! HEP!
H E P is een acroniem:

H = Hierosolyma [Jeruzalem / Jeroeshalajim]
E = Est [is]
P = Perdita [verloren, vernietigd, ten gronde gericht, vergeten]

En de andere crowdbedielen roepen op crowdpedia:

One theory is that it is an acronym from the Latin "Hierosolyma est perdita" ("Jerusalem is lost"), said (without verifiable evidence) to have been a rallying cry of the Crusaders. [...] There is no contemporary evidence for the "acronym theory".

Deze debiel met zijn jaren 70 blog? Die zegt Quidquid latine dictum, altum videtur.

Coffee Module, Spotlight meets Drupal

El solo de guitarra
If you own a mac, you use spotlight daily. Or even better, use Alfred. A great way to navigate faster with a keyboard towards the app or data you need.

A very long time ago a Boy Wonder made something like this for Drupal 5, navigating through the /admin pages using a simple spotlight alike interface, see the menuscout module. Unfortunately, Boy Wonder, he wandered off and the module gained dust.

Then some time ago co-worker Michael Mol showed me a module he has been working on. Since he was doing D6 and D7 development at the same time and since the URL's changed and developers use URL's as well for navigation, he decided to d a spotlight alike search on the admin pages so he could remember the name, not the URL. It ended up being coffee, for now a sandbox project but anyday now a real project in d.o. To see it in action, take a look at this screencast.

Think of coffee as spotlight for the admin interface. And if you want an easter egg like the do a barrel roll, get active in this issue.

Drup dot al

My very own Hansel and Gretel
Every day or so I try to browse so modules that might be of use for customers. Not that my team is afraid of building own modules. Not at all as the Hansel module for example shows. A rather cool module for developers to make better breadcrumbs that we build for the NCRV.nl and was donated by them. Not afraid to make own modules that make "awesomeness happen". But using Open Source means building on the shoulders of giants and no matter how tall you are, there is always someone taller then you. So despite being 2 meters tall, I always look for smarter people writing interesting code/functionality.

So the other day I came across the Drupal anywhere module that uses twitters anywhere service. Anyway, clicking the demo link brought me to... drup.al!

And this is what I wrote about that domain-name back in 2006:

If Drupal would have started in 2005 and Albania would have had a real NIC, we wouldnt have claimed drupal.org but drup.al.


But we arent followers, not here to be hip and we were twodotooo before Tim could spell it out. So we are Drupal.org, rocking without being Beta Two Dot Oooh!

Drup.al

And I still think it is true today. Even if Time gave an excellent keynote at DrupalCon SF. Drup.al is a funny domain-name. Demoing a nice module, that is all it is. And when the Albanian NIC was any more open back in 2001 when I registered drupal.org I am sure I would have looked at drup.al as well. Nice domain name, but search engines are the new DNS, Google is the new Bind. Funny name, drup.al. But most outsiders already think that the name Drupal by itself is funny enough.

What Google could do to make its' service even better on mobile devices (spelling)

I love my iPhone and I love Google. And the combination of these to leads to a nice user experience; when an iPhone user visits Google with Mobile Safari. Google reads the user-agent string and gives the user a page optimized for the user experience on the phone. As stated before, it is not the user that should change and go to m..example.com but the site that adepts to the user('s browser).

This leads to an optimized situation, one can swipe through images in Google images and has the least HTML overhead when visiting Google.com. There is however one thing google can do better. Spelling. Okay, there is also one thing I could do better, but that is not my point :-)

If google reads a search string and a user-agent, they could guess if the user/iPhone made a small error on the keyboard and hint to that word, just like the iPhone itself most of the times does.

So when I would search for "Ftupal" Google should see this and even though the word Drupal has only a few characters the same, changes are that I wanted to press the D next to the F and the R next to the T.

Doing this makes Google smarter then the iPhones' OS. And better at spelling and syntax as me are. For sure.

Woordenwolk Troonrede 2009


(Woordenwolk / tagcloud van de troonrede 2009. Groter op flickr. Volledige tekst van troonrede oa op ad.nl.)
Ik blijf me afvragen waarom "traditionele" media dit soort nieuwe technieken van visualisatie online niet meer toepassen. Zie ook Regaeerakoord 2007 in een woordenwolk en de krantenoplage in een tagcloud.

U bent minder grafisch ingesteld en wilt de raw breakdown (noisewords deleted)?



27 regering
15 zijn
13 worden
12 wordt
11 ons
11 mensen
11 meer
11 burgers


10 land
10 kunnen
10 jaar
9 zal
9 wil
9 dat
8 zorg
8 onze
8 2009
7 vertrouwen
7 niet
7 nederland
7 krijgen
7 goed
7 daarom
6 samen
6 nederlandse
6 komt
6 groei
6 goede
6 economische
6 deze


5 wij
5 vergroten
5 veiligheid
5 u
5 samenwerking
5 onderwijs
5 nodig
5 leefomgeving
5 kinderen
5 jongeren
4 werken
4 vrijheid


and this is how you do it:
cat troon.txt | tr -d ',.' | tr [[:blank:]] '\n'| tr [A-Z] [a-z] | sort | uniq -c | sort -nr | head -20

update: ik bedoelde natuurlijk: troonrede /voor/ 2009, niet van 2009

XML feed